Interested in working with a rapidly growing organisation that has high standards and strong performance in health and safety? We are currently recruiting a Health and Safety Advisor to lead on a flagship construction project. The organisation has grown into a leader in the infrastructure space, with a turnover of approximately 30 million. With a strong commitment to health and safety, this newly created role is designed to support the company's continued growth. This role is perfect for someone looking to shape their career while fostering safer work environments.

Responsibilities:

  • Assisting with health and safety, implementing health and safety policies and procedures, and ensuring compliance with health and safety legislation.
  • Conducting toolbox talks and inductions and investigating incidents where required.
  • Contributing towards undertaking audits and inspections of the site, identifying areas for improvement, and reporting on the findings.
  • Working with the team to look for health and safety improvements.

Requirements:

  • Experience in a similar role, ideally within construction.
  • A NEBOSH Certificate (or equivalent).
  • Excellent organisational skills with the ability to manage competing priorities.
  • Strong communication skills, with the ability to engage with a broad range of stakeholders.

This position will require a self-starter who can lead by example and hit the ground running.

Some tips for your application 🫡

Tailor Your CV: Make sure your CV highlights relevant experience in health and safety, particularly within the construction sector. Emphasise your NEBOSH Certificate and any specific achievements that demonstrate your ability to implement health and safety policies effectively.

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that showcases your passion for health and safety and your commitment to fostering safer work environments. Mention how your skills align with the responsibilities outlined in the job description, such as conducting audits and engaging with stakeholders.

Highlight Relevant Skills: In your application, clearly outline your organisational skills and ability to manage competing priorities. Provide examples of how you've successfully communicated with diverse stakeholders in previous roles.

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, carefully proofread your CV and cover letter for any spelling or grammatical errors. A polished application reflects your attention to detail, which is crucial in a health and safety role.
